1. **State the problem:** Given the probability of event $A$ as $p(A) = 0.4$, find the probability of the complement of $A$, denoted as $A^c$.
2. **Formula used:** The probability of the complement of an event $A$ is given by:
$$p(A^c) = 1 - p(A)$$
This is because the total probability of all possible outcomes is 1.
3. **Calculate the complement probability:**
$$p(A^c) = 1 - 0.4$$
4. **Simplify:**
$$p(A^c) = 0.6$$
5. **Interpretation:** The probability that event $A$ does not occur is 0.6, meaning there is a 60% chance of the complement event happening.
